I believe with all my heart that God speaks in a variety of ways.
He often communicates to me through my circumstances. I might hear a perfectly timed song on the radio that comforts or convicts me.
Sometimes God will speak to me through my husband or a friend or even a stranger. He also speaks on occasion through my dreams. I especially treasure the times the sound of God’s still small voice speaks directly into my thoughts.
Even though I’ve heard God speak in a variety of ways, He speaks to me mostly through the Bible. I’ll go so far as to say that I don’t think He’s likely to speak in other ways unless I regularly read the Bible. In other words, because I read, study and memorize God’s Word, I’m more apt to hear His voice whenever and however He chooses to speak to me.
Last Sunday the guest speaker at our gatherings admonished my church to read the gospels every month. With four gospels, that means reading each one three times a year.
Imagine what you might hear God say.
